Summary
NKCC1 modulates BP through vascular and renal effects. In addition to BP regulation, the decreased baseline activity of this carrier or its suppression by chronic treatment with HCDs may lead to inhibition of myogenic tone and progression of end-stage renal disease. NKCC1 activation in ischemia-induced acidosis may contribute to stroke via glutamate release caused by astrocyte swelling.
